Default 9.0.6 losing Mbox Pro communication

So since I went from 9.0.5 to 9.0.6, my Mbox Pro continually loses communication with the computer on relaunching of Protools at random times. Sometimes it comes up, sometimes not. I have to keep unplugging and replugging the firewire and then reselecting Mbox 2 in the playback engine dropdown. I also keep having the hard drive that is connected to the mbox unmount itself (device removal). (Yes, I know the chain order is wrong and the mbox should be at the end, but this system has worked flawlessly until the recent upgrade) ALSO, I am now having tons of -8068 buffer underflow errors and my buffer is as high as it can be, 1024, CPU at 85%, 2 processors, level 2 on the other buffers. I'm on an Imac 2.16Ghz, 4 GB Ram, OSX 10.6.8. Like I said, this setup was working flawlessly until the upgrade....
Either that, or the other culprit could be a brand new GTech drive out of the box that I think is bunk and acted weird since I plugged it in. Trouble mounting from the start, couldn't copy from it after the initial copy I made to it, and now on another laptop, I can't even reformat it with disk utility....so that is back in the box and not going near the Imac. Could it have fried my firewire bus?
The Gtech and upgrade were right around the same time, but I can't remember if I ran any sessions on 9.0.6 before the drive issue.

Any help? This is killing my workflow and I have a film with a deadline.

Default Re: 9.0.6 losing Mbox Pro communication

Just an update for anyone with similar issues....my Firmware and drivers have been up to date. I've narrowed it down to a firewire port, drive or Imac issue. I was using an older Glyph firewire drive possibly with a bad interface, that since I removed and started working off a different drive, this issue has stopped happening to the degree that it was.... I still occasionally get the usual old device underflow, where I have to unplug/replug the Mbox, but this is usually after some inactivity or sleep from the computer. The disk unmounting issue has stopped with removal of that Glyph (even though that drive was on the other firewire port from the Mbox). An issue I have also noticed, that my Imac won't boot up with any firewire drives connected and actually powered up before the computer. It gets to the grey boot screen, but no apple logo, and it stays there until I power down. I have to wait for it to boot, then power up the drives. Most likely time for a new Imac, but I've at least found a workaround to the work stoppage.
